The short version

BendWell collects nothing about you. There is no account to create, no analytics, no advertising, no tracking, and no third-party code of any kind inside the app. Nothing you do in BendWell is sent anywhere, because the app does not contact the internet at all while you use it.

Reminders

If you switch on the daily reminder, BendWell asks your phone to show you a notification at the time you chose. It is scheduled by your phone, locally. No reminder is sent from a server, and there is no push notification token — so no one, including us, knows whether you were reminded or whether you practised.

Buying BendWell

The one-time purchase is handled entirely by Apple's App Store. Your payment details go to Apple and never to us — we never see your card, your name, or your address. The app asks Apple a single question, "has this Apple Account bought BendWell?", and Apple answers yes or no.

Apple's own privacy policy covers that transaction. Apple later shows us anonymous sales totals, which are counts of purchases by country; they do not identify anyone.

This website

This site sets no cookies, runs no analytics, and loads no fonts, scripts, or images from anywhere else. Our hosting provider keeps ordinary server logs, which include IP addresses, for a short period for security and reliability. We do not use them to identify or profile visitors.
